Synopsis:

A Bermuda high will be responsible for warm to hot conditions through much of the upcoming week. A mix of sun and clouds is expected. A late day or night isolated storm is possible later today (mainly to the South) with more humid air working in. Scattered storms are possible later Tuesday with an approaching weak cool front.

The 4th of July forecast looks like a winner right now. Sunny skies with highs in the upper 80s.
